Doublejump Books is fairly good at making strategy guides.


Keep in mind its up to the developers to supply materials and the like for the strategy guides. In addition, some developers prefer more hands-on approaches when it comes to making them. Square Enix is pretty much the main reason why guides like FFIX and DQ8 tended to suck.

Is Bradygames really that bad? I loved the guide that they made for ToS and GrandiaIII. ToS's guide was perfectly made. It was very easy to read/follow, formatted neatly, organized correctly, and still visually pleasing. I also liked the author that worked on ToS's book. All of the instructions were typed without ANY spoilers. Only short clear directions (important for people that dislike reading from a strategy guide for *too* long).

Take for example, SO3' guide. I took a look while playing through the game for a while, and I hated the fact that every major turn in the story was spoiled through the strategy guide. As long Bradygames continues to make strategy guides in the same way as they did with ToS, I have no problem.
